Eugene Ciolek compiled a career batting average of .260 with 12 home runs and 0 RBI in his 262-game career with the Springfield Cardinals, St. Augustine Saints, Gainesville G-Men and DeLand Red Hats. He began playing during the 1941 season and last took the field during the 1947 campaign.
